Things to do
Buy a ticket to Cairo's Pyramids at Giza, and Tutankhamun's gold mask in busy Downtown. Islamic Cairo's Al-Azhar Park near the Citadel is a green oasis. On Rhoda, celebrate the late, great singer at Umm Kulsoum Museum.
Shopping
A holiday to Cairo is not complete without bargaining for hand-blown glass or silver at world-famous Khan el-Khalili market in Islamic Cairo. Upmarket Gezirah is the place for stylish jewellery and local crafts. Egyptians love the huge modern malls in Heliopolis.
Restaurants
After your flight to Cairo, sample local delicacies in unpretentious Downtown restaurants or mezze (snacks) before dinner. Wealthy locals dine at glamorous restaurants like El Morocco, springing up on Nile houseboats around Zamalek.
Nightlife
Buy a ticket for Cairo Opera House in Zamalek to hear classical Arabic music. Gezira's bars are perfect for smoking fruity sheesha pipes, or drinking huge quantities of tea. Make the most of your Cairo city break watching belly-dancing at Downtown's Haroun Al-Rashid.
